First Post ... so hi all first ^^

Alot of people mentioned FFXI on the first page and just as a little side note ... in FFXI a sleeped mob does NOT and i repeat NOT build hate against anything you do as long as you dont attack it. The CC spell itself does cause threat against the caster who applies it. I tried that out alot of times ... We had 5 sleeped Puks and i uses Benediction ... no mob went on me ... same goes for Divine Seal + Curaga IV while 5 yagudos were sleeped in a BCNM ... if they would have been awake nothing could have saved me.

In World of Warcraft it is the same actually. You can easily check that with Threatmeters. A sheeped mob only has hate from the mage that sheeped it and it doesnt matter how often the priest heals around the party ... even if he heals the mage that sheeped the mob.

IMO a sleeping mob should not build hate while he sleeps because it kills the purpose of CCing it in the first place. If i need to hold hate on it even while it sleeps i can just normal tank it as well ... and whats the point of using a CC spell to control a linked mob while you fight 2 others and after you are done the half party gets whacked because the mob runs amok.
